    A decent point I suppose, against a pretty good side. Holloway has found a way to play that is functional and effective, but not very attractive. No criticism though, he needed to stop the rot and he has done that. We do lack quality in the attacking third, though. Sylla is not very good and Mackie is just Mackie. Washington added something I thought, but we are desperately in need of a striker in the transfer window.

    As with the Reading game, possession statistics don't tell the real story. Playing the ball sideways and backwards inside your own half shouldn't count as possession. I found it amusing to watch their two big lump CBs passing to one another, then forwards to a midfielder who would give it straight back because we had closed down all of their outlets. Fulham have quality players in Cairney and Oluko, but they also have some duffers. Fat-boy Chris Martin was joined by fatter-boy Matt Smith at the death. Surely the most immobile front two in professional football.

    For our part Smithies was excellent again (6 out of 10 penalties saved for us), Mackie was admirable for his work-rate and Lynch was tough as nails, but MOM has to go to Manning. How could we have thought of letting him go?
